Florence, WI - July 26, 2009
The 115th Upper
Peninsula Firefighters Tournament ended Saturday Morning as it began
Thursday evening; with a parade. The Saturday parade down Central Avenue,
described as the Commercial Parade, includes public participation in
addition to the firefighters.
Yesterday's parade was like most parades we enjoy. It included floats,
firefighters and of course fire trucks. The Honor Guard was a
motorcycle group called the "Patriot Guard". Among the Fire Trucks in the
parade were two classic trucks; a 1930 Ford owned by the Breitung Township
Fire Depart and a 1917 Ford, the proud possession of the Florence Fire
Department, host for this year's tournament.
West Iron County had several entries in the parade, all in keeping with
the tournament theme "South of the Border. There were many local
float entries . One highlight of the parade was a convertible carrying Ray
and Lorraine Steber, celebrating 75 years of marriage. Also in the car and
waving to the crowds along the parade route was Irene Meress, 100 years
"young".
Also riding in an purple convertible Jeep, was 2009 Florence County
Fair Queen Kattie Rinkowski.
